This small, bronze medal, made by an anonymous artist in 1596, depicts the "Closing of the Triple Alliance" between England, France, and the Republic. The obverse side shows two figures, likely representing England and France, shaking hands, symbolizing the unity of the alliance. The reverse side shows a boar, representing the Republic, beneath a tree with a crown, signifying the alliance's power and authority. The medal is a reminder of this historical event and the complex diplomatic relationships of the time.
